Intermodal Containers: The Backbone of Global Trade
Intermodal containers, typically described simply as shipping containers, are an important aspect of modern logistics and global trade. Presented in the mid-20th century, these standardized boxes enable the seamless transport of goods by means of numerous modes of transport, including ships, trains, trucks, and more. Their influence on the supply chain has been profound, helping with increased effectiveness and minimizing shipping costs.
What are Intermodal Containers?
Intermodal containers are large standardized boxes developed for the efficient handling and transport of cargo. They are built from long lasting materials like steel and aluminum and be available in different sizes, mainly created for ease of stacking and transport. The intro of intermodal containers revolutionized shipping as it made the process of moving goods from one mode of transport to another considerably simpler.
Types of Intermodal Containers
Intermodal containers come in a number of types tailored for particular cargo needs:

The intermodal transport system describes the collaborated use of various transport modes in shipping products. This system is not only about the containers however also about how they are dealt with across numerous points in the supply chain. Here's a short summary of how intermodal transport works:

Q1: What is the basic size of intermodal containers?A1: The most typical sizes are 20 feet and 40 feet, however other sizes are also readily available, including 45-foot containers. Q2: What is the difference in between a dry cargo container and a reefer container?A2: Dry cargo containers are developed for non-perishable goods, while reefer containers are refrigerated and used for transferring perishable items. Q3: How are intermodal containers protected during transport?A3: Containers are generally protected utilizing twist
locks throughout shipping, and they are developed to endure severe conditions. Q4: Can intermodal containers be customized?A4: Yes, there are choices for tailoring containers for specialized cargo requirements, such as insulation, insulation, or modifications for ventilation. Q5: How do intermodal containers contribute to sustainability?A5: Intermodal containers assist decrease the carbon footprint of shipping by helping with efficient transport and minimizing the variety of managing steps.
